Description
The barn at Elmhurst, located to the north of the house, is a small building from the 19th century. It is constructed with flint and features red brick dressings, quoins, and a modillion eaves cornice. The roof is half-hipped and covered with slate. On the east front, there is a round-headed loft doorway. This barn is included in the listing for its group value with the surrounding structures.
